Translation of Spanish word "hacia" to English
hacia
/ˈa.θja/
Meaning
VerbIn the direction of something (indicated by context).
How to use
Hacia ('towards / around') indicates direction or approximate time. Hacia el norte — Towards the north. Hacia las tres — Around three o'clock.
🇬🇧 English
towards
Example
Él camina hacia el parque.
He is walking towards the park.
Miramos hacia el horizonte.
We look towards the horizon.

Common phrases
- hacia arriba— upwards
- hacia adelante— forward / ahead
